Anyways, give these a try tonight and let me know if it helps:
1)Cool down your brain: a study showed that if you keep your bedroom at a cooler temperature or sleep on a cooling mattress pad, you’ll have a better sleep. Good luck changing that thermostat, it may be safer to just stuff a sleeping bag with ice.
2)Take magnesium before sleep: helps you calm down, relax, chill, and then sleep!
3)Do this breathing technique: inhale and count to four, in your head, not out loud cause that’s difficult. Then hold your breath for the count of seven seconds, and then exhale to a count of eight…repeat until you fall asleep or pass out cause you lost count.
4)Sleep with your socks on: cold body, warm feet helps you sleep, and keeps your socks safe from your dog.
5)Splash your face with cold water: it will cause a shock and response to your nervous system, and can also be hilarious if your spouse says, “I can’t sleep”.
